YAG
YAG is an actonym for yttrium
aluminum garnet, a man-made
imitation diamond. This imitation
stone lacks the fire of a
natural diamond.
YELLOW GOLD Yellow gold is gold
that has been alloyed with
a mix of 50% copper and 50%
silver.

Y NECKLACE
Usually 16 to 18 inches in
length, this style of necklace
gets its name from its shape
which features a dangle forming
a Y-shape around the neck.
YTTRIUM
A silvery metallic element
of the boron-aluminum group,
found in gadolinite and other
rare minerals, and extracted
as a dark gray powder. Not
a rare earth but occurring
in nearly all rare-earth minerals,
used in various metallurgical
applications, notably to increase
the strength of magnesium
and aluminum alloys.
